[Claims for Utility Model Registration] (1) A plurality of elevating bodies having suction pins at the lower ends are provided so as to be movable up and down and rotatable with respect to the head frame, a clutch is provided corresponding to each elevating body, and the clutch is activated. A driven shaft and a driving shaft are pivotally supported on the head frame side, and each driven shaft and the corresponding elevating body are interlocked by a transmission mechanism, so that each driving shaft rotates in the same direction and by the same angle. A mounting head for a component mounting machine, characterized in that the rotary drive shaft and each driving shaft are interlocked by a winding transmission mechanism, and the rotation angle of each elevating body is determined by the connection time of the clutch. (2) A mounting head for a component mounting machine according to claim 1, wherein the elevating body is driven up and down by a cam mechanism.
